Everything You Need to Know About Evil Proxy Attacks and MFA Bypass
Attackers use a malicious proxy server to intercept, monitor, and manipulate communication between a client and a legitimate server, often to steal credentials, session tokens, or other sensitive information. Some services provide “Phishing-as-a-Service” (PhaaS), offering attackers ready-made tools and infrastructure to conduct phishing campaigns.
